Base Load. The ASC instructional assignment will be 40 hours per week and will require that the faculty member provide 32 scheduled hours per week of contact hours and ASC service student contact hours. The remaining 8 hours may be used for scholarly work, college service, professional development, etc. ASC faculty will teach in two academic terms per year and a standard base workload of 4 ASC courses or 3 ASC courses and 1 College credit course per term. ASC faculty may teach and be paid for overload courses as collaboratively scheduled between the supervising academic ▇▇▇▇ and the faculty member. ASC faculty will be evaluated by their academic ▇▇▇▇.
